黑狐家游戏

数据库设计中的概念结构设计的主要工具是什么,数据库概念结构设计之核心工具解析

欧气 0 0

本文目录导读:

数据库设计中的概念结构设计的主要工具是什么,数据库概念结构设计之核心工具解析

图片来源于网络,如有侵权联系删除

  1. 数据库概念结构设计的主要工具

数据库概念结构设计是数据库设计过程中的重要阶段,它涉及到对现实世界的抽象和建模,在这一阶段,设计者需要使用一些工具来帮助构建出符合实际需求的概念模型,本文将深入探讨数据库概念结构设计的主要工具,旨在为数据库设计者提供有益的参考。

数据库概念结构设计的主要工具

1、E-R图(实体-联系图)

E-R图是数据库概念结构设计中最常用的工具之一,它能够直观地表示实体、实体之间的联系以及实体的属性,E-R图主要由三个基本元素构成:实体、联系和属性。

(1)实体:实体是现实世界中具有独立意义的对象,如学生、课程、教师等,在E-R图中,实体用矩形表示,矩形内标注实体的名称。

(2)联系:联系表示实体之间的关联关系,如学生选课、教师授课等,在E-R图中,联系用菱形表示,菱形内标注联系的类型,如“选课”、“授课”等。

(3)属性:属性是实体的特征,如学生的姓名、年龄、性别等,在E-R图中,属性用椭圆表示,椭圆内标注属性的名称。

2、UML类图

数据库设计中的概念结构设计的主要工具是什么,数据库概念结构设计之核心工具解析

图片来源于网络,如有侵权联系删除

UML(统一建模语言)类图是数据库概念结构设计中的另一种常用工具,它能够描述实体、实体之间的关联关系以及实体的属性,UML类图与E-R图类似,主要由三个基本元素构成:类、关联和属性。

(1)类:类是现实世界中具有共同属性和行为的对象集合,如学生类、课程类、教师类等,在UML类图中,类用矩形表示,矩形内标注类的名称。

(2)关联:关联表示类之间的关联关系,如学生选课、教师授课等,在UML类图中,关联用实线表示,实线两端分别连接两个类的名称。

(3)属性:属性是类的特征,如学生的姓名、年龄、性别等,在UML类图中,属性用括号表示,括号内标注属性的名称。

3、模糊E-R图

模糊E-R图是针对现实世界中具有模糊边界和复杂关系的实体而设计的一种概念结构设计工具,它通过引入模糊集合的概念,将现实世界中的模糊实体和关系转化为数据库中的概念模型。

4、层次模型

数据库设计中的概念结构设计的主要工具是什么,数据库概念结构设计之核心工具解析

图片来源于网络,如有侵权联系删除

层次模型是一种树状结构,它将实体组织成层次结构,每一层代表实体的一个集合,层次模型在数据库概念结构设计中的应用较为有限,但在某些特定场景下,如企业组织结构、家族关系等,具有较好的表现。

5、网状模型

网状模型是一种图形结构,它将实体和实体之间的联系表示为网状关系,网状模型在数据库概念结构设计中的应用较为复杂,但在某些特定场景下,如交通运输、城市规划等,具有较好的表现。

数据库概念结构设计是数据库设计过程中的关键环节,选择合适的工具对于构建出高质量的概念模型至关重要,本文详细介绍了数据库概念结构设计的主要工具,包括E-R图、UML类图、模糊E-R图、层次模型和网状模型,设计者在实际应用中,可根据具体需求和场景选择合适的工具,以实现高效、准确的数据库概念结构设计。

标签: #数据库设计中的概念结构设计的主要工具是( )

黑狐家游戏
  • 评论列表

留言评论